25 START-UP SOCIAL BUSINESSES SHORTLISTED BY MA’AN FOR ABU DHABI’S FIRST SOCIAL INCUBATOR PROGRAM

Tuesday 06 August 2019
Abu Dhabi - MENA Herald:

A total of 25 teams have been shortlisted by the Authority for Social Contribution – Ma’an to proceed to the pitching phase of their social incubator program, which aims to grow business ideas with a community focus into social enterprises and not-for-profit associations.

It follows a highly competitive selection process which saw more than 130 ventures applying to Ma’an Social Incubator. The first cycle of the incubator will provide solutions for challenges faced by people of determination.

Applications received ranged between ideas and start-ups in the UAE and around the world including as far afield as Brazil, Denmark, France, Nigeria and India. Some of the applications that made the shortlist include technology solutions, assistance living solutions and services, education enhancements and recreational opportunities.

The shortlisted teams will now compete for final 10 places on the Ma’an Social Incubator program, starting in September, where more than AED4.4million will be available in the form of milestone funding and support in the form of mentorship, office space, business expertise and access to investors.

As part of the next stage in the selection process, all 25 teams will receive support to prepare them for the final pitch event where they will be coached on the fundamentals of developing a successful pitch. After this, they will pitch their venture to a judging panel at the end of August who will select the final 10 teams that will participate in the incubation program.

The first initiative of its kind in the UAE capital, Ma’an will run annual programs on a regular basis around a different social challenge or priority - with the aim of encouraging more not-for-profits associations and social enterprises that contribute towards the common good.

Successful applicants will be supported with funding and business development support.

The final 10 teams will get access to workshops and training programs to hone their business skills and understand more about the particular social challenge of each cycle, such as understanding more about the lives of people of determination.

The program offers unique and valuable networking opportunities for the teams to build relationships with individuals outside of the program, including investors, third sector leaders and regional and global industry figures. Ma’an will organise ‘demo days’ for the final 10 teams to be able to leverage funding from investors.

Ma’an will invest more than AED4.4 million per cycle – with each team eligible to receive milestone funding up to AED 200,000 released at every successful milestone the participant reaches as well as stipend for living expenses and housing costs for participants not based in Abu Dhabi.
